Idiom of the Day
touch off (something) or touch (something) off
to cause something to fire or explode by lighting the fuse
The fire at the oil refinery touched off an explosion that destroyed many tanks.

Fact
While still in college, Bill Gates and Paul Allen once built a special purpose machine called Traff-O-Data. It was a machine that would analyze information gathered by traffic monitors. They never found any buyers.
